Lycom Rises 19% on Expectations of Gains from AI Data Centers and Defense Sector [Featured Stock]

[Edaily Reporter Shin Ha-yeon] #Lykom is up more than 19% in early trading.
According to MP Doctor on the 5th, as of 9:19 a.m. today, Lycom’s stock price is trading at 5,850 won, up 19.14% from the previous trading day.
This is interpreted as a result of investor sentiment being stimulated by forecasts from the securities industry that the company will simultaneously benefit from expanded orders for optical amplifiers for AI data centers and growth in its defense and aerospace businesses.
In a report released today, Heo Seon-jae, an analyst at SK Securities, stated, “The reasons to pay attention to Lycom right now are that the order backlog for optical amplifiers is surging as the construction of AI data centers in North America gains momentum starting this year, increasing the visibility of earnings growth, and that the new defense and aerospace businesses, which have been in preparation for the past 10 years, are expected to begin contributing significantly to earnings.”
Lycom is a specialist in optical communication components, producing optical amplifiers for AI data centers and telecommunications infrastructure, as well as fiber lasers for defense and aerospace applications. Its major clients include Fujitsu, NEC, LIG Nex1, and Hanwha Systems.
Analyst Heo explained, “Lycom supplies optical amplifiers—essential for high-capacity data transmission (DCI) between AI data centers—to global optical transmission equipment manufacturers such as Fujitsu and NEC.” He added, “These products are used in the construction of optical transmission networks for companies like AT&T, Verizon, and NTT, and ultimately serve to process data traffic between the AI data centers of big tech firms such as Google, Amazon, and Microsoft (MS).”
He noted, “The order backlog for optical amplifiers in the first quarter reached 6.5 billion won, a 171% increase year-over-year,” and added, “On the 4th, the company signed a 3.9 billion won contract with Onefinity, a subsidiary of Fujitsu, to supply optical amplifiers for 800Gbps coherent optical transceivers, marking the beginning of tangible orders for North American AI data centers.”
He also predicted that the defense business would enter a phase of full-scale growth. Analyst Heo noted, “As drones have emerged as a key asymmetric capability in recent warfare, laser weapons are rapidly gaining attention as next-generation anti-drone weapon systems,” and analyzed, “As a key laser light source supplier participating in the domestic laser air defense weapon localization project, Lycom is expected to directly benefit from the expansion of mass production of laser weapon systems in the future.”
He further projected that, based on expanded orders this year, Lycom will enter a phase of significant earnings improvement starting next year. Researcher Heo noted, “2026 will be the first year in which orders for optical amplifiers for North American AI data centers and fiber lasers for defense applications begin in earnest,” adding, “Revenue for 2027 is projected to reach 43.2 billion won, a 91.6% increase from the previous year, while operating profit is expected to reach 10.1 billion won, a 1,106.4% increase.”
